Apollo 45681-300APO Integrated Base Sounder - DIN-Tone with IsolatorThe Integrated Base Sounder comprises of a base sounder with integral mounting base and is for use with Discovery or XP95 ranges. It is designed for indoor use.Electrical DescriptionThe integrated base sounder is line powered and needs no external power supply. It operates at 1728V DC and is polarity-sensitive.Mechanical ConstructionThe integrated base sounder is moulded in polycarbonate and has stainless steel contacts that accept solid or stranded cables of up to 2.5mm.Device AddressingADDRESSING The integrated base sounder responds to its own individual address set with a DIL switch. It also responds both to a group address set by means of a 4-segment DIL switch and to a pulsed-mode synchronisation address which is embedded in the unit. GROUP ADDRESSING It may be desirable in alarm conditions to switch more than one integrated base sounder simultaneously. To enable this sounders may be controlled as a group and given a group address which is common to all sounders in the group. When a device recognises its group address it will process the forward command bits but it will not return any data to the control panel on that ad dress. Apollo Intelligent Auto-Aligning Beam Detector SA7100-100APOThe Intelligent Auto-Aligning Beam Detector combines a transmitterreceiver in the same detector head with an automatic alignment motor. This combination with integrated addressability allows for quick and simple installation. The Intelligent Auto-Aligning Beam Detector automatically compensates for environmental effects on the beam signal keeping the unit in the best possible working order. This is achieved through the combination of software automatic gain control and motorised realignment of the beam.OperationThe Intelligent Auto-Aligning Beam Detector is a compact detector for detecting smoke in large open areas such as warehouses theatres churches and sports centres. It comprises a ground level loop-powered controller a detector head with an operating range of 8m-50m and a single prism. The operating range of each detector head can be increased up to 100m by using the Extension Kit which comprises of three additional prisms.An additional detector head can be connected to the controller. Each head has a loop address. It also has a built in 20T negative bi-directional short circuit isolator and it is compatible with control panels using CoreProtocol Discovery and XP95 protocol. A built-in laser provides rapid initial alignment and thereafter the detector head will continuously automatically align and compensate for any building movement.The status of each detector can be monitored through the controller which is sited at ground level. The detector head operates both as a transmitter and a receiver. A well-defined IR beam is projected to a prism mounted on the opposite wall which is reflected back to the receiver. In the event of smoke partially obscuring the light an imbalance between the transmitted and received light will occur. The detector will then transmit an alarm value to the control panel.The detector is factory set to a beam obscuration of 35 which is the best setting for most factories and warehouses. The setting can be changed to 25 for offices and clean areas such as theatres or to 50 for hostile areas such as mills or foundries. The detector reports a pre-alarm analogue value 48 at approximately 75 of the alarm threshold. The detector compensates automatically for gradual contamination of the lenses in order to avoid false alarms.
